Health Insurance Costs In Türkiye

All citizens and people who intend to stay in Turkey for more than 1 year must have health insurance. Istanbul also recommends the use of insurance for short stays. Foreign residents in Türkiye can insure themselves.

The cost of health insurance in Turkey depends on factors such as the type of insurance and the amount you pay annually. According to Turkish law, all people under 17 years old and over 65 years old are not required to pay insurance. The cost of health insurance for people aged 18 to 23 years is about 400 liras and for people between 23 to 65 years old it is about 3000 liras per year. If your treatment process requires several sessions, you have to pay between ten and forty percent of the cost yourself. If you do not have a specific and severe illness, you can benefit from the free services available in pharmacies.

What Does Health Insurance Cover In Türkiye?

If you have health insurance in Turkey, it covers the following:

  • Hospitalization costs
  • Outpatient treatments
  • Hospital services such as operating room, anesthesia, laboratory, radiology, etc.
  • Organ transplant costs
  • Chemotherapy, radiation therapy and dialysis
  • Dental and nose surgery treatments resulting from accidents or injuries
  • All microbiology and pathology tests
  • Radiology and imaging
  • M.R.I
  • Hospitalization costs in special care units
  • Drug costs
  • Visiting a doctor and performing all necessary tests to diagnose and prevent diseases

What Are Not Covered By Health Insurance?

The following are not covered by health insurance in Türkiye:

  • Natural disasters (such as floods, earthquakes, landslides)
  • War injuries
  • Riot injuries
  • Injuries caused by terrorist acts
  • Injuries caused by nuclear radiation
  • Professional sports injuries such as skiing
  • Vaccinations
  • Diseases related to alcohol and drug use
  • Rehabilitation measures
  • The topic of artificial organs
  • Buy glasses, walking stick
  • Covid-19
  • Also, injuries caused by the use of items that are not known as public transportation and expenses related to diseases that the traveler had before coming to Turkey are not covered by the insurance.

The Cost Of A Doctor’s Visit In Türkiye

If you have valid residency or insurance, your expenses will be significantly reduced. For example, if you have a permanent residence in Turkey, you do not need to pay for a visit to a general practitioner. The cost of visiting a specialist doctor depends on the place of visit (private or public hospital) and the type of insurance. The approximate cost of visiting a specialist doctor in Turkey is between 70 and 200 Turkish Liras.

Introduction To SGK Insurance

Healthcare services in Türkiye have wide sectors. All these services are provided by Social Security Institute of Turkey or SGK for short. In other words, all types of Turkish government insurance are known as SGK insurance. This insurance covers both medical services and provides facilities for retirement.

SGK insurances are generally divided into three types:

Social Security Insurance (SSK)

This insurance is usually provided by employers for employees and workers. Also, foreigners can benefit from government insurance if they have a legal job and a work permit in Turkey. This insurance also provides pension services.

Self-Employment Insurances

This insurance is specifically for self-employed people, those who own their own business or have registered a company in their name in Turkey. Foreigners can also use this insurance. This insurance also provides pension services and facilities.

General Health Insurance (GSS)

Compared to the previous two types, this insurance has less services and is very affordable from an economic point of view. Unemployed people can also use this insurance policy. Of course, it should be noted that this insurance only allows you to use government medical facilities and does not provide pension services.
